Kinmochi Shrine

The good name is Yukari Kinmochi, a warlord who appears in the "Taihei-ki" (Taihei-ki). Kageto, who had escaped from Oki and stood up at Funakamiyama (Senjo-san), had raised his army in accordance with Emperor Go-Daigo, reportedly prayed for a must-win here. Because of its military and the name of "Kanemochi", many worshipers from all over the country visit in search of opening and gold luck.

Mandarin observation hut

The prized mandarin duck, which is a bird of Tottori Prefecture and is also listed in the Red Data Book of the Environment Agency, flies to the Hino River in Hino-cho every year from November to March. The numbers have increased since the "Hinomachi Mandarin group", formed by the townspeople, began to bait, and now about a thousand birds come. There is a small observation hut along the Hino River, which can be observed in close proximity.

Katsumiya (Kansai Wide Area Area Farm and Forestry Fishing Experience Minshuku)

An old private house of registered tangible cultural property over 110 years of construction. Get, watch, eat, play, and stay, and live, an inn of experience-type farmers who can revive the five senses. In addition to making country dishes using homemade rice and seasonal vegetables (3000 yen), agricultural and harvesting experiences such as rice planting and rice harvesting (1500 yen for 120 minutes), you can also enjoy nature such as walking to the nearby headwaters of St. Waterfall and climbing rivers. You can also experience the observation of the giant salamander, a special natural monument of the country.
